This is Nicole Kristine Cable who went missing from her home in Glenburn, Maine on Sunday, May 12th at around 9 p.m.

Her parents have stated that she apparently had been talking to a ‘Bryan Butterfield’ on Facebook, and she had plans to meet with him that evening.

The Facebook profile under Butterfield’s name has been taken down since word has gotten out about Nichole’s disappearance.

The Facebook account also seems to be fake, with neither of the two young men above being Bryan Butterfield or ever being associated with such an individual. The true identities of these two men has been identified and they have been cleared of any involvement in this case.

She was last seen wearing light colored jeans and a light gray sweatshirt.

If anyone has any information about Nichole’s whereabouts, please contact the Penobscot County Sheriffs Department at (207) 947-4585.
